Meier will be an RFA with arb rights
QO: 1 year, $10 million
Arb: 1 year, $8.5 million
It wouldn’t be player elected arbitration, would only be team-elected, which means before the draft, at end of 2022–23 season.
That means SJS has to file for arbitration, then find a trade partner, then grant permission to negotiate a contract. From the player perspective, if he doesn’t get the contract he wants from new team, he can fall back on the Arb award just as he could have with the QO. So arb does not change those dynamics all that much.
